  5. Trusting God means being wholeheartedly confident in Him and His character. It means knowing He will do what He says He will do, and that He’ll never act contrary to His character as disclosed in Scripture.

    • To Trust Is to Place Your Confidence Only in God. Trust in the Lord with all your heart, and do not lean on your own understanding. (Proverbs 3:5) To trust in the Lord means more than believing in who he is and what he says; the word here for trust can also mean “to have confidence in.”
    • To Trust Is to Acknowledge God in Everything. In all your ways acknowledge him, and he will make straight your paths. (Proverbs 3:6) Acknowledging God means knowing God wherever we are and whatever we are doing.
    • To Trust Is to Fear the Lord. Be not wise in your own eyes; fear the Lord, and turn away from evil. (Proverbs 3:7) Putting trust in the wisdom of man, looking to ourselves—both individually and corporately—is futile in the extreme.
    • To Trust Is to Receive Life from Christ. It will be healing to your flesh and refreshment to your bones. (Proverbs 3:8) Trust in and fearful awe of the Lord revives.
